Tournaments

The Pacific Pinball Expo offers five different tournaments to choose from, hosted by Keith Elwin, current World Pinball Champion!

  • Each ticket is good for 2 plays in the tournament (except Bingo).
  • Enter anytime, as many times as you want, until the finals.
  • Best top 3 scores on each machine go into the finals.
  • Additional prizes from Professional/Amateur Pinball Association (PAPA) will be awarded.

Guest Speakers

Saturday and Sunday, October 4th and 5th, will feature an impressive array of pinball luminaries, on-hand to discuss repair tips (Clay Harrell (Shaggy, from This Old Pinball) and Chris Kuntz), pinball art projects (William Wiley, Wade Krause, and Jim Dietrick, creators of the Punball art-pinball), and the future of the Pacific Pinball Museum (Lucky JuJu owner Michael Schiess)!

Other Activities (schedule to be announced)

Contest for "Best" machines

Bring your lovingly resurrected EM pinball machine and show off your restoration ability. Contests for "Best Restored", "Best Modified", and "Most Original" games will be held with prizes and praise for the winners! Besides bragging rights, the winner will receive an engraved lucite desk trophy.

Auction

During the Expo several pinball machines will be either raffled off or put into a silent auction. Those games are Cinema, Sky Jump, and Spin Out.

Clinics

"How To" Clinics on everything from buying, set up and maintaining your first pinball, troubleshooting tips, to playing techniques, to cabinet restoration! Electro Mechanical and Solid State repair, Fun and informative sessions for players and techies of all ages and experience levels!

Pinball Trivia Game

Think you know pinball history? Think you can name that game in "2 features"? Then come and compete in our "History of Pinball Trivia Game", 6:30pm Saturday!

Velvet Rope Area

PPE is compiling a collection of very rare antique games for a special "Velvet Rope" playing area. These games will be available to play for a small additional fee. These are games that are very rarely seen in playing condition, if at all. Historical Exhibit

There will be a display of games from Richard Conger's Silverball Ranch chronicling the evolution of pinball from the turn of the century to the dawn of the flipper era. These games will not be available to be played, but will offer an insight into the development of the game we have come to know and love.

The Physics and Science of Pinball

This is an exhibit group that introduces visitors to some of the concepts and mechanisms of pinball. Its focus is electricity, magnetism and physics. Following are descriptions of some of the exhibits and what they demonstrate. Details...
